Terminal Doppler Weather Radar (TDWR) is a Doppler weather radar system with a three-dimensional "pencil beam" used primarily for the detection of hazardous wind shear conditions, precipitation, and winds aloft on and near major airports situated in climates with great exposure to thunderstorms in the ...
St. Joseph, colloquially known as St. Joe, is a city and the county seat of Berrien County, Michigan. It was incorporated as a village in 1834 and as a city in 1891. [4] As of the 2020 census, the city population was 7,856. [5] It lies on the shore of Lake Michigan, at the mouth of the St. Joseph River, about 90 miles (140 km) east-northeast of ...

The St. Joseph Catholic Church is a Roman Catholic parish church in the Roman Catholic Archdiocese of San Antonio, located at 623 East Commerce Street in downtown San Antonio, Texas, United States. [2] The Gothic Revival [3] house of worship was the fourth Catholic parish in the city.
